The Installation Process

Understanding the sliding door installation process can help property owners understand what to expect from local installers.

  1. Assessment and Measurement: The initial step involves examining your area, discussing your requirements, and taking precise measurements.
  2. Product Selection: Depending on the design and design of your home, homeowners can pick between numerous materials, such as wood, vinyl, or aluminum.
  3. Preparation: The installers will prepare the opening, ensuring it's square and level. This step is essential for an appropriate fit.
  4. Installation of Frame and Door: The frame is installed, followed by the sliding door. If it's a large door, additional hands might be required to develop a smooth installation process.
  5. Last Adjustments and Cleanup: The installers will make changes to make sure the door operates smoothly and tidy up any debris before leaving.

Maintenance Tips for Sliding Doors

To extend the life-span of your sliding doors, follow these maintenance suggestions:

  • Regular Cleaning: Dust and particles can collect on the door tracks. Routinely tidy them with a wet cloth.
  • Lubrication: Apply lubricating oil to the tracks regularly to make sure smooth operation.
  • Inspect Seals and Weatherstripping: Regularly check for wear, which can help keep energy effectiveness.
  • Inspect Rollers: Ensure that the rollers are operating well. If you observe irregular operation, contact your installer for suggestions.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

What kinds of sliding doors can be set up?

Sliding doors been available in numerous types, such as standard sliding patio doors, bi-fold doors, and pocket doors, each serving various functions and aesthetics.

The length of time does the sliding door installation process take?

Depending upon the intricacy and size, installation can take anywhere from a couple of hours to a full day.

Are sliding doors energy-efficient?

Modern sliding doors can be energy efficient when they feature proper insulation and double- or triple-paned glass. Search for products with ENERGY STAR certification.
